Output 8e4f8fda8cc5d42f6d43913c7605f6375c029f8553f87e190d857504b94efcf6:0

value
5696318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 299c4a66d57dd75ca673b845a231bf1f227c7920 OP_EQUAL
address
35V2rfwjzbCbxn9fcHcTEkZcAjE6Qiu2w9
transaction
8e4f8fda8cc5d42f6d43913c7605f6375c029f8553f87e190d857504b94efcf6
confirmations
357381
spent
true